... Read moreThe Opill has stirred conversations about accessibility and affordability in contraception. Being the first over-the-counter (OTC) birth control option, it offers numerous benefits, especially for individuals seeking privacy and ease in obtaining contraception. Traditionally, many young people have faced hurdles in accessing prescribed birth control due to parental restrictions or the need for doctor visits, making Opill a significant breakthrough. Priced reasonably, it can be acquired in bulk from stores like Costco, making it more accessible to various demographics. Additionally, the FDA has approved Opill as a prescription-strength option, ensuring that users receive safe and effective contraception. In making a decision about whether to use Opill, consider your personal health needs and consult with a healthcare expert if possible. Understanding how to properly use an oral contraceptive is crucial; users must take a tablet daily at the same time to ensure maximum effectiveness. While Opill doesn't require a prescription, the importance of being informed about potential side effects and health implications remains essential. This new OTC option could reshape contraceptive access for many, allowing them more autonomy over their reproductive health.
